OverviewRenee McCullah, daughter of Hall-of-Fame GA Tech quarterback Darrell Crawford and former wife of a SEAL Team Six Master Chief, has known all types of celebrities in spheres of Hollywood, sports, and politics. However, SEAL Team Six is in a class of their own. Imagine leaving the high-profile, fascinating world of Hollywood to enter the clandestine hub of Navy SEAL-dom and the harsh realities of being a Navy SEAL wife. In Unsealed, you will gain access to the mystique of the elitist, renegade Naval Special Warfare Command SEAL Team Six, unveiling the secretive world of Frogman & Company. Table of ContentsReviewsAuthor InformationRenee McCullah, skilled communicator and writer, is mother to daughters Michaela and Victoria. She began her modeling career being selected for the Atlanta Fashion Board, which parlayed into pageantry where she was honored as Miss Georgia-World, finalist for Miss World-USA, and first runner-up for Mrs. Virginia. She was also on the first established Atlanta Hawks Professional Dance Team in 1979.She continued with an acting career beginning with landing a role in fan fave, ""The Cannonball Run."" Included in her film and television work was talk show host, culminating with a memorable Charlie Daniels interview. She would also become the recipient of the AMTC competition for the Role Model and Mature Commercial Division Awards.Renee is co-founder of the Virginia Beach chapter of Concerned Women for America, Education and Legal Defense Foundation. She was deputized to serve on the Citizens Panel for Child Welfare in Georgia, became a certified Christian counselor, and is an honored member on the board of F.A.M.E. Ministries.
